Overview of Ethanol Fireplace Inserts
Ethanol fireplace inserts have emerged as a popular choice for homeowners seeking a modern and stylish way to heat their spaces. Unlike traditional wood-burning or gas fireplaces, ethanol inserts utilize bioethanol fuel, a renewable source derived from the fermentation of plant materials. This eco-friendly option allows for a clean burning process without the need for venting, making these inserts suitable for a variety of spaces, including apartments and homes where conventional fireplace installations can be challenging.
One of the standout features of an ethanol fireplace insert is its ease of installation and use. Most models are designed to be simple to set up; many can simply be placed into an existing fireplace or wall cavity without requiring extensive modifications. Additionally, ethanol fuel is readily available and easy to maintain, as it comes in pre-packaged containers that can be poured directly into the burner. This convenience is particularly appealing for those who wish to enjoy the ambiance of a fire without the hassle of wood chips or gas lines.
Ethanol fireplaces also offer a unique aesthetic appeal, providing a contemporary focal point to any room. With a range of designs and finishes, from sleek modern to rustic styles, homeowners have the flexibility to choose a look that complements their décor. The flames created by ethanol fuel provide a realistic fire experience, creating warmth and atmosphere while eliminating the smoke and soot associated with traditional fireplaces.

Installation and Maintenance Tips for Ethanol Fireplace Inserts
When it comes to installing an ethanol fireplace insert, proper preparation and adherence to manufacturer guidelines are crucial. Begin by ensuring that the intended installation site is clean and free of flammable materials. It’s also advisable to have a level surface to place the insert on, as stability is essential for safe operation. Some models may come with specific installation instructions or require a professional installer, which should be reviewed beforehand.
Once installed, maintaining an ethanol fireplace insert is relatively simple. Regular cleaning is necessary to keep the glass panels and surrounding surfaces free of soot and dust. A mixture of vinegar and water can effectively clean these surfaces without the use of harsh chemicals. Additionally, always check the fuel box for any residue that might accumulate over time, and ensure that it is properly functioning before refilling with bioethanol.
Safety is paramount when using an ethanol fireplace insert. Always follow the safety instructions provided by the manufacturer, including allowing the flame to fully extinguish before refueling. It’s also wise to keep the area around the fireplace clear of combustible materials and to monitor the fireplace while in use. Comparing Ethanol Fireplace Inserts to Other Heating Options
When evaluating heating options for your home, it is essential to consider how ethanol fireplace inserts compare to traditional and alternative heating methods. One of the most significant differences lies in their operational mechanics. Unlike wood or gas fireplaces, which require venting and flue systems, ethanol fireplace inserts can be installed in a variety of settings without extensive modifications. This feature makes them particularly attractive for city dwellers or those seeking to minimize renovation costs.
Energy efficiency is another area where ethanol fireplace inserts hold an advantage. They burn cleaner than traditional wood-burning fireplaces, which can waste a lot of heat up the chimney. Although bioethanol may not provide the same level of heat as a gas fireplace, the eco-friendliness and low emissions contribute to a more sustainable home environment. Additionally, since ethanol fireplaces do not rely on electricity, they can serve as a reliable heat source during power outages.
However, it’s important to acknowledge that ethanol inserts may not be suitable as a primary heating source for larger spaces. They are best utilized for supplementary heating, enhancing the overall comfort of a room while adding visual appeal. Comparatively, electric heaters, while convenient, may not provide the same level of ambiance and warmth that an ethanol fireplace can. Can I use any type of fuel in my ethanol fireplace insert?
It is vital to use only the specific type of bioethanol fuel recommended by the manufacturer of your ethanol fireplace insert. Using incorrect or inappropriate fuels can pose safety risks, such as incomplete combustion, excessive smoke, or even dangerous flare-ups. Most inserts are designed to work optimally with high-quality denatured ethanol, which combusts cleanly and offers efficient heat output.
Using the correct fuel not only enhances safety but also prolongs the life of your fireplace insert. Low-quality or unapproved fuels may lead to residue buildup and damage the internal components of the insert over time. Always read the product manual and adhere to the manufacturer’s recommendations to ensure proper operation and maintain the safety of your fireplace insert.

How much heat can an ethanol fireplace insert generate?
The heat output of an ethanol fireplace insert can vary widely based on its size, design, and fuel capacity. Typically, these inserts can produce anywhere from 1,500 to 5,000 BTUs (British Thermal Units) of heat per hour. This output should be sufficient for moderate heating needs in smaller spaces, such as living rooms or bedrooms. However, for larger areas, you may need to use multiple inserts or supplementary heating sources.
It’s also important to consider the efficiency of the insert in converting fuel to heat. Higher-quality inserts generally provide better heat efficiency, allowing for longer burn times with less fuel consumption. Always check the product specifications for the specific heat output of the insert you are considering to ensure it meets your heating requirements effectively.
